Examining Your Lawn and Planning the Design



When you're prepared to set up an automatic sprinkler, the primary step is evaluating your backyard and intending the format. Begin by observing the size and shape of your yard. Recognize locations that need watering, such as flower beds, grass, and veggie gardens. Bear in mind of sunlight exposure and any kind of shaded places, as these aspects influence water needs.


Next, consider the water stress offered to you. Test it making use of a basic pressure scale to confirm your system can operate successfully. Plan the positioning of sprinkler heads based upon protection; you'll desire them to overlap somewhat to stay clear of dry spots.


Map out a harsh design, noting the places of the main lines and lawn sprinkler heads. Think of the kinds of lawn sprinklers you'll utilize and their reach. Planning thoroughly now will certainly make your installment less complicated and validate your plants receive the ideal quantity of water.

Figuring Out Trench Deepness



Determining the best trench deepness is crucial for guaranteeing your lawn sprinkler functions successfully. Typically, you'll wish to dig trenches concerning 6 to 12 inches deep, relying on your local climate and the kind of pipes you're using. Deeper trenches help avoid pipes from freezing if you live in an area with freezing temperatures. Make sure to take into consideration the size of your pipelines; bigger pipelines might need much deeper trenches for appropriate setup. Furthermore, check neighborhood codes or laws, as they might determine particular depth requirements. As you dig, keep the trench size convenient-- around 12 inches is generally adequate. By doing this, you can quickly mount and access the pipes when required, guaranteeing your system operates smoothly.

Setting Up Sprinkler Heads and Valves



Installing sprinkler heads and valves is an important action in producing an effective irrigation system for your lawn or garden (Sprinkler tune-up). Begin by positioning the lawn sprinkler heads at the significant places, making specific they're uniformly spaced for optimal protection. Dig a small hole for each and every head, validating it's deep enough for proper installation


Following, connect the sprinkler heads to the pipes, securing them tightly to stop leakages. Usage Teflon tape on the strings for additional guarantee.


When it pertains to valves, check here choose a location conveniently obtainable for maintenance. Install the valves according to the producer's directions, linking them to the mainline pipes. Make sure they're level and protected, as this will assist with consistent water circulation.


Ultimately, test each lawn sprinkler head and shutoff for appropriate function before hiding any kind of pipes. This step guarantees your system operates efficiently and successfully, providing the ideal look after your plants.


Connecting the Key Water Supply



With the lawn sprinkler heads and valves firmly in position, you'll currently connect the primary water supply to your irrigation system. Beginning by locating the major water line, typically near your home's structure. Shut off the water to avoid any kind of leaks or spills throughout the process. Next off, use a pipeline cutter to produce a clean cut in the primary line, making particular it's the ideal dimension for your fittings. Set up a T-fitting to divert water right into your automatic sprinkler. Ensure it's firmly secured, and usage Teflon tape on the threads for a watertight seal. After that, attach the PVC pipe causing your automatic sprinkler to the T-fitting. Validate all links are tight and leak-free. When every little thing remains in place, turn the water back on slowly, looking for any leaks at the joints. This step is essential for a smooth operation of your lawn sprinkler system.


Testing the System and Modifications



After you have actually attached the major supply of water, it's time to check your lawn sprinkler system. Switch on the water and observe how each zone operates. Walk your backyard to examine for even insurance coverage, guaranteeing no areas are completely dry or too wet. It may indicate a lawn sprinkler head is blocked or misaligned if you observe any dry spots. Readjust the heads as necessary to route water where it's required most.
